ISIS carries out a new attack west of the Euphrates targeting the regime forces and their allies of Syrian and non-Syrian nationalities in the frame of its targeting to the area

Deir Ezzor Province – The Syrian Observatory for Human Rights: violent explosions and gunfire were heard in the eastern countryside of Deir Ezzor, intersected sources confirmed to the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ights that they were caused by violent clashes between the regime forces backed by armed militiamen loyal to them of Syrian and non-Syrian nationalities against the members of the “Islamic State” organization, in areas in Al-Salihiyah Desert in the west of the Euphrates River, as well as other areas in the vicinity of M’eizileh area, amid the sounds of explosions in the area, caused by shelling accompanying the clashes between the both parties, amid targeting operations in the clashes areas, and there is information about confirmed human losses in the ranks of the both parties.

This new attack by the members of the organization, comes within a series of attacks by the “Islamic Sate” organization, on the area where the regime forces backed by armed militiamen loyal to them of Syrian, Arab and Asian nationalities are located, where the Syrian Observatory monitored on the 2nd of September 2018, the outbreak of clashes between the regime forces and militiamen loyal to them of Syrian and non-Syrian nationalities, against members of the “Islamic State” organization, in areas in al-Bokamal desert in the eastern countryside of Deir Ezzor west of Euphrates River, and the clashes were accompanied by intense exchange of shelling in the clash areas between both parties, while the Syrian Observatory monitored bombardment by warplanes on areas of presence of attacking ISIS members, and information about casualties in the ranks of both parties, the Syrian Observatory has also published that it documented the death of at least 13 of regime’s loyal gunmen, and the Syrian Observatory documented the death of at least 8 members of the organization, also caused the clashes that took place in the area between al-Mayadin city and al-Dwayr Desert and in al-Tim Oilfield area south of Deir Ezzor airbase; has injured several other of both parties, where the Organization seeks to inflict the largest possible number of casualties in the ranks of the regime forces and its Syrian and non-Syrian allies, while the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ights was monitoring on Saturday, the 1st of September 2018, that the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ights monitored that the pace of fighting decreased in the front which is stretched from Al-Mayadin city to al-Dwayr Desert, in the west of the Euphrates River in the eastern countryside of Deir Ezzor, and in the area of Al-Taim Oilfield which is located in the south of Deir Ezzor city and at a distance of about 12 km away from its military airbase, where the SOHR monitored the fall of casualties as a result of the violent shelling and clashes which took place in the area, between the regime forces and gunmen loyal to them of Syrian and non-Syrian nationalities against the members of the “Islamic State” organization, where the SOHR documented the death of 9 members at least of the gunmen loyal to the regime, and information about more human losses in their ranks, as well as other casualties in the ranks of ISIS members, where the clashes were accompanied by bombardment by warplanes on the organization’s areas of presence, amid exchange of targeting in the clash areas between the both parties.
